Reviews These winter-busting gloves from French brand DXR are relatively cheap, and definitely cheerful

Customers are impressed with the quality and fit of the DXR gloves, finding them warm and comfortable for winter riding. Despite some reports of bulkiness, the gloves are praised for their excellent construction, good leather, and tough knuckle protection. A few customers noted that the cuffs could be longer for better coverage over jackets. Some reviews mention that the gloves are not warm enough for extreme cold without heated grips. Overall, they offer great value, many customers highly recommend them for colder rides.
